O que é um Sistema de Atualizações?
Um Sistema de Atualizações é uma ferramenta essencial que permite a manutenção e melhoria contínua de softwares e sistemas operacionais. Esses sistemas são projetados para garantir que os usuários tenham acesso às versões mais recentes de aplicativos, correções de segurança e novas funcionalidades. Através de atualizações regulares, os desenvolvedores podem corrigir bugs, melhorar a performance e oferecer uma experiência mais segura e eficiente aos usuários.
Importância das Atualizações de Software
As atualizações de software são cruciais para a segurança e a funcionalidade de qualquer sistema. Elas ajudam a proteger os dispositivos contra vulnerabilidades que podem ser exploradas por hackers. Além disso, as atualizações podem incluir melhorias de desempenho que tornam o software mais rápido e responsivo. Ignorar essas atualizações pode resultar em um sistema desatualizado, vulnerável e com desempenho inferior.
Tipos de Atualizações
Existem diversos tipos de atualizações que um Sistema de Atualizações pode oferecer. As atualizações de segurança são as mais críticas, pois corrigem falhas que podem ser exploradas por cibercriminosos. As atualizações funcionais, por outro lado, introduzem novas funcionalidades e melhorias na interface do usuário. Também existem atualizações de manutenção, que visam corrigir erros e melhorar a estabilidade do software sem adicionar novas funcionalidades.
Como Funciona um Sistema de Atualizações?
Um Sistema de Atualizações geralmente opera em segundo plano, verificando periodicamente se há novas versões disponíveis. Quando uma atualização é detectada, o sistema pode baixar e instalar automaticamente as novas versões, ou notificar o usuário para que ele possa optar por realizar a atualização manualmente. Esse processo pode variar dependendo do software e das configurações do usuário, mas o objetivo principal é garantir que o sistema esteja sempre atualizado.
Benefícios de um Sistema de Atualizações Automatizado
Um Sistema de Atualizações automatizado oferece uma série de benefícios significativos. Ele reduz a necessidade de intervenção manual, garantindo que as atualizações sejam aplicadas de forma oportuna e eficiente. Isso não apenas economiza tempo, mas também minimiza o risco de falhas de segurança, já que as correções são aplicadas assim que estão disponíveis. Além disso, sistemas automatizados podem ser configurados para realizar atualizações fora do horário de pico, evitando interrupções nas atividades do usuário.
Desafios na Implementação de Sistemas de Atualizações
Apesar de seus muitos benefícios, a implementação de um Sistema de Atualizações pode apresentar desafios. Um dos principais problemas é a compatibilidade entre diferentes versões de software e hardware. Atualizações que funcionam bem em um sistema podem causar problemas em outro. Além disso, os usuários podem hesitar em aplicar atualizações devido a preocupações sobre a estabilidade do sistema ou a perda de funcionalidades que estavam acostumados a usar.
Atualizações em Dispositivos Móveis
Nos dispositivos móveis, o Sistema de Atualizações é igualmente importante. As atualizações em smartphones e tablets não apenas melhoram a segurança, mas também podem otimizar o desempenho e a duração da bateria. Muitos fabricantes de dispositivos móveis oferecem atualizações regulares para garantir que seus produtos permaneçam competitivos e seguros. A falta de atualizações em dispositivos móveis pode levar a uma experiência de usuário insatisfatória e a riscos de segurança.
Atualizações em Sistemas Operacionais
Os Sistemas Operacionais (SO) são um dos principais focos de atualizações. Sistemas como Windows, macOS e Linux frequentemente lançam atualizações para corrigir vulnerabilidades, melhorar a interface e adicionar novas funcionalidades. A gestão eficaz dessas atualizações é crucial para a segurança e a eficiência do sistema. Os usuários devem estar cientes da importância de manter seus sistemas operacionais atualizados para evitar problemas de segurança e desempenho.
Futuro dos Sistemas de Atualizações
O futuro dos Sistemas de Atualizações está se tornando cada vez mais integrado com tecnologias como inteligência artificial e machine learning. Essas tecnologias podem prever quando uma atualização é necessária e até mesmo automatizar o processo de instalação, tornando-o mais eficiente. Além disso, a crescente preocupação com a segurança cibernética está levando a um foco maior em atualizações rápidas e eficazes, que podem ser implementadas sem a necessidade de intervenção do usuário.